Your social security rights when moving in Europe

The EU Commission has developed a very useful practical guide, which provides you with easily understandable information about your rights and obligations in the field of social security. It is strongly recommended that, before moving to another country in the European Union, you familiarize yourself with the appropriate chapters of this guide. 
There you find answers to questions such as:

  • In which country are you insured? 

  • What are your rights and obligations in this country? 

  • What you should know in the event of sickness or maternity 

  • Accidents at work and occupational diseases 

  • Invalidity - still a problem 

  • Who pays my pension? 

  • In the event of death: survivor's benefits and death grants 

  • What to do in the event of unemployment? 

  • What about family benefits?

Which are my rights as a: 

  • Frontier worker 

  • Seasonal worker 

  • Posted worker 

  • Pensioner 

  • Student 

  • Tourist 

  • Non-active person 

  • Third-country national


Common European format for CVs

The European curriculum vitae gives a comprehensive standardised overview of education attainments and work experience of an individual. The European CV provides information on:

  • Language competences;

  • work experience;

  • education and training background

  • additional skills and competences acquired outside formal training schemes

You can download the European CV in 13 languages from the CEDEFOP website
